Nicholas Wade McGuire, 8, of Will Edwards Road, Mill Spring, N.C. died Saturday, Nov. 22, 2014 in Mission Hospital, Asheville, N.C. as the result of an automobile accident that also claimed the life of his grandmother, Isabel Davis Laughter.

Born in Surry County, N.C. he was the son of Brian McGuire of Will Edward Road, Mill Spring, N.C. and Elizabeth K. Burchette of Elkin, N.C. Nicholas moved to Polk County in 2011 coming from Elkin, N.C. He was a second grader in Lake Lure Classical Academy. He attended Pleasant Hill Baptist Church, Elkin, N.C. where he was active in Awana Sparks.

Surviving along with his parents are: a brother, Alan Dakota Hartzog of Elkin, N.C.; two sisters Ashley McGuire and Laura McGuire of Max Meadows, Va.; step brothers Bryson Laughter, Tyler Laughter and Clayton Burns all of Mill Spring, N.C.; stepmother, Julia Laughter of Mill Spring, N.C.; maternal grandparents, Garvey and Kay Burchette of Elkin, N.C.; a great-aunt, Gerry Leigh Miller of Winston Salem, N.C. and several cousins.

Funeral services were held Wednesday, Nov. 26, 2014 in Beulah Baptist Church, Mill Spring, N.C. with Rev. Joel Wright officiating.

Family received friends from noon – 2 p.m. prior to the service in Beulah Baptist Church, Mill Spring, N.C.

Burial will be held 2 p.m. Friday, Nov. 28, 2014 in the Pleasant Hill Baptist Church Cemetery, Elkin, N.C. with Rev. Steven Harrelson officiating.
